A remark on Gwinner's existence theorem on variational inequality problem
Gwinner (1981) proved an existence theorem for a variational inequality problem involving an upper semicontinuous multifunction with compact convex values. The aim of this paper is to solve this problem for a multifunction with open inverse values.

Simple incentives and diverse beliefs
This paper studies a moral hazard problem in which the principal does not know the agent's beliefs about the output generating process. The agent is risk neutral, transfers are subject to limited liability, and the principal evaluates contracts according to their worst‐case payoff against a rich set of plausible agent beliefs.
